org.gradle.api.tasks.TaskExecutionException: Execution failed for task ':app:processDebugManifest'
本文共 513 字,大约阅读时间需要 1 分钟。
一、问题描述
在尝试将另一个Android项目下的模块导入当前项目时,可能会遇到Manifest资源文件的问题。错误提示通常是“Manifest资源文件中有问题了,赶紧去检查吧”。这个错误通常发生在项目合并或签名过程中,提示开发者需要仔细检查AndroidManifest.xml文件。错误信息可能会包括具体的资源冲突或缺失。
二、解决办法
要解决这个问题,可以按照以下步骤操作:
打开项目的AndroidManifest.xml文件,确保文件结构完整,版本一致。 检查是否有多个Manifest文件被合并,点击右侧的“Merged Manifest”选项,查看具体的错误信息。 根据提示修改AndroidManifest.xml中的相关配置,确保所有必要的元数据完整且不重复。 如果错误仍然存在,可以尝试清除项目缓存,重新编译并测试。 如果问题依然存在,可以参考以下错误示例:
- 错误提示可能指出某个资源ID或名称已经在另一个Manifest文件中被声明多次。
- 需要确保主Manifest文件和其他合并的Manifest文件没有重复的资源声明。
通过以上步骤,通常可以解决Manifest资源文件的问题,确保项目能够顺利运行。
转载地址:http://mwvfk.baihongyu.com/